Sorry, just to clarify, did you rank your preferences and THEN were reached out to for a regional interview?
Sorry.. yes, I ranked all of the offices, then the specific office reached out to set up a regional interview. My timeline (roughly) was this: October OCI; around thanksgiving ranked preferences; mid-December receive call from regional office asking me to come in the following week for an interview. Now I'm waiting. If it helps, I didn't rank HQ first.

Anonymous User wrote:Has there been any movement for anybody?
Wondering the same thing. USACE qualified in December, but haven't heard from any district offices. I was told hiring is completely up to those offices who are encouraged to hire Honors attorneys for openings at the GS12 level. There is no deadline so hires can be made up until the next year's program. I was hoping to hear something by January or February. Otherwise I will have to look at other options after my clerkship.

Anyone hear from USACE offices yet and, if so, do you mind sharing which general area?
